McDonald’s prices are cutting out customers who make less than $45,000 a year, which is about one-third of Americans. It hasn’t hurt the Golden Arches – by any measure, business is booming. But it’s a stark reminder that a growing number of people in the US are struggling to afford the basics. Bloomberg Opinion’s Nir Kaissar breaks down the data to explain why it’s time to add burgers to the list of what separates the haves and have-nots.
